POLICE are urgently appealing for witnesses after a cyclist was killed in a road crash outside a Romsley pub.

The incident happened at around 7.40am on Thursday morning (June 15) on Bromsgrove Road, near to the Swallow's Nest pub.

It is believed that a silver Vauxhall Corsa was travelling from Poplar Lane and collided with a silver Ford Transit.

The vehicles subsequently crashed with a cyclist who was travelling on Bromsgrove Road.

Paramedics were on the scene within eight minutes while the Midlands Air Ambulance was also called out.

A West Midlands Ambulance Service spokesman said: “The middle aged cyclist had suffered significant injuries in the crash.

“He received considerable treatment from the ambulance staff and air ambulance doctor but sadly, despite the extensive efforts it wasn’t possible to save him and he was confirmed dead at the scene.

“No-one else was hurt.”

West Mercia Police has since launched an appeal for witnesses, and is asking anyone who saw the crash, or the manner in which the vehicles were being driven, to come forward.
